Reduction by Pelvic External Fixator Followed by Innominate and Derotational Femoral Osteotomies for Late Presenting Bilateral Developmental Dysplasia of the Hip
Introduction Bilateral developmental dysplasia of the hip is a challenging situation, closed and open reduction with or without pelvic and femoral osteotomies are all proposed.
